Causes of Leaf Drop
πͺοΈ Environmental Stress Factors
Overwatering
Overwatering is a common culprit behind leaf drop in flax. Symptoms include yellowing leaves, wilting, and root rot, highlighting the need for well-drained soil to maintain flax health.
Underwatering
On the flip side, underwatering can lead to dry, crispy leaves and eventual leaf drop. Recognizing signs of drought stress is crucial for keeping your flax thriving.
Temperature Extremes
Flax prefers a cozy temperature range of 15Β°C to 25Β°C (59Β°F to 77Β°F). Exposure to frost or extreme heat can severely impact leaf health, causing stress that leads to leaf drop.
Sunlight Exposure
Flax plants thrive in full sun, requiring 6-8 hours of sunlight daily. Insufficient light can result in weak leaf vitality, making it essential to position your plants where they can soak up the sun.
π₯¦ Nutrient Deficiencies
Nitrogen Deficiency
A lack of nitrogen manifests as yellowing of older leaves and stunted growth. Nitrogen is vital for healthy foliage, so addressing this deficiency is key to robust plant health.
Phosphorus Deficiency
Phosphorus deficiency shows up as dark green leaves with purple undertones. This nutrient plays a crucial role in root development and flowering, making it essential for a flourishing flax plant.
Potassium Deficiency
Symptoms of potassium deficiency include marginal leaf burn and overall weakness. Potassium is important for stress resistance and water regulation, so ensuring adequate levels is critical.

π¦ Diseases Affecting Flax
Root Rot
Root rot is characterized by wilting, yellowing leaves, and mushy roots. It often results from overwatering and poor drainage, making proper watering practices vital.
Fungal Infections
Common fungal diseases like Fusarium wilt and downy mildew can severely affect leaf health. Identifying symptoms early can help in managing these infections effectively.

Diagnosing Leaf Drop Issues
Identifying Symptoms πΏ
Diagnosing leaf drop in flax begins with observing visual cues. Yellowing leaves often indicate nutrient deficiencies, while browning leaves can signal environmental stress.
Understanding the pattern of leaf drop is also crucial. A sudden drop may suggest a severe issue, while gradual leaf loss often points to ongoing stressors.
Assessing Soil Conditions ποΈ
Next, evaluate your soil conditions. Soil texture and drainage play a significant role in flax health; well-draining soil prevents root rot and promotes healthy growth.
Additionally, check the soil pH levels. The ideal range for flax is between 6.0 and 7.5, ensuring that nutrients are accessible for optimal plant health.
Evaluating Watering Practices π§
Watering practices are another key factor in diagnosing leaf drop. Maintain a consistent watering schedule, aiming for deep watering to encourage robust root development.
Be vigilant for signs of overwatering or underwatering. Overwatered plants may exhibit yellowing leaves and wilting, while underwatered flax will show dry, crispy leaves and potential leaf drop.
